**Q: How do crash reports from the Lanternlight app reach the triage queue?**

A: Crashes are captured on-device by the Fireline SDK, batched, and uploaded when the app regains connectivity. The Dovetail ingest service deduplicates stacks before writing them to the triage queue in Arbormill. If the ingest service loses its encrypted credential bundle — typically after a region failover — you must re-unlock it manually. Maintainers should do this promptly to avoid report loss. The bundle's recovery passphrase is stored on the line below.

unlock words, tawif-tahop: oliys-ulawyn-tamdor-lamys-casox-jormir-fraius-kasath-ulador-ulamir-holir-sorys-holeth

# Build provenance — Fernwick OTA channel

Firmware pushed through the Fernwick update channel must carry a signed provenance manifest. Plugin authors submit artifacts to the staging ring first; promotion to stable requires an unbroken attestation chain from source checkout to packaging. Unsigned or re-packed images are rejected at ingest, no exceptions. To confirm your submission landed in the channel, match it against the trace token shown below.

build token for haduf-bafog: htk21_2d98ce91a83676b65394a

## Key Ceremony Checklist — Item 9: Job Queue Migration Keys

Welcome aboard. During this ceremony we retire the signing keys for Brambleway's homegrown job queue, since the new Taskforge pipeline replaces it next sprint. Verify the old queue is fully drained, confirm no workers hold cached credentials, and have both witnesses sign the retirement form. When the form is countersigned, open the escrow envelope using the recovery passphrase printed just below.

unlock words, hahip-baduf: holwyn-istath-julvan